For example if you're only worried about cleaning up the … WebJul 30, 2024 · 349. The .gitignore file ensures that files not tracked by Git remain untracked. Just adding folders/files to a .gitignore file will not untrack them -- they will remain tracked by Git. When working in a local repository, Git will track every file under the Git repo. Every file, can be tracked (i.e. already staged and committed), untracked (not staged or committed) or ignored..
